Would You Marry A Man Who Once Raped You?

Becky is in a dilemma and she surely needs your advice. She has just made a shocking discovery that Martins, the man she is about to get married to in two months' time happened to be one of the bad guys who raped her as a virgin teenage girl several years ago.

That sad event turned her into a man hater, not until she met Martins four years ago. Now a changed man, he was the dream of every woman and swept her off her feet.

Right now, Becky is so mad that her old feelings of man-hating are coming back and she now has deep seated hatred for Martin.

But their wedding is just around the corner, the invites out and all family members ready for the big day. She is in two minds and needs advise so as to know what to do.
